Retrievable Encryption Algorithms for Sensitive Information of Scanner Devices

Abstract:

In order to improve the security of obtaining sensitive information, a searchable encryption algorithm for scanner device sensitive information is proposed. Firstly, a feature weighted grey correlation analysis method is adopted to fill in the missing data in the sensitive information of the scanner equipment, in order to obtain complete sensitive data. Secondly, based on the editing distance between sensitive data and user requested query data, the similarity coefficient between the two data is calculated, and a keyword index is constructed using sensitive data with a similarity coefficient greater than the threshold. The index data is sorted in descending order of similarity coefficient. Finally, the KNN(K-Nearest Neighbor) algorithm is used to encrypt and decrypt the keyword index data. The experimental results show that the algorithm has high information retrieval accuracy and good data encryption effect.
